In fact, of the 11,000 known species of birds, only 60 species are flightless and about a third of those are penguins. Penguins are flightless birds often associated with cold temperatures and icy habitats.

Penguins are highly specialized for their flightless aquatic existence; Penguins are birds of the ocean, spending up to 75 percent of their lives in the water. The most iconic species is the emperor penguin, with its striking black and white feathers and bright.
